Hamish and Kate    by Mark Macpherson
Price: $0.99 USD. 55180 words. Published on November 30, 2011. Fiction.

Is Hamish and Kate the greatest love story ever told? Whether it is or not, it is certainly one of the more elaborate and heartfelt tales. Forty years of interruptions and resumptions would test all but the greatest of loves. Each twist and turn is disquieting and unexpected. Hamish and Kate is a haunting story of dissatisfaction with the spoils of love and of a life lived with regret.
The First Genesis    by Mark Macpherson
Price: $0.99 USD. 38990 words. Published on November 28, 2011. Fiction.

The world was created for, and because of, one incredible woman. She was the template for modern humans. The Mayan god, Hachakyum, created the modern human world in her image and lived among the ancient Mayans as her companion. These are the stories of that woman's amazing life. One woman caused the beginning of the modern human world, and Hachakyum's love for her will cause the world's end.
At the end of the world    by Mark Macpherson
Price: $0.99 USD. 67610 words. Published on March 30, 2011. Fiction.

(3.00 from 1 review)
Archaeologist Arthur Dawkins discovers the tomb of a god from the Mayan creation stories. There is a grain of scientifically plausible truth in the beliefs of the ancient Mayans. Enough to cause the end of the world...
